ABSTRACT:
Because of the illposedness of soft field, the
quality of EIT images is not satisfied as expected. This paper puts forward a
threshold strategy to decrease the artifacts in the reconstructed images by
modifying the solutions of inverse problem. Threshold strategy is a kind of
post processing method with merits of easy, direct and efficient. Reconstructed
by Gauss-Newton algorithm, the simulation image’s quality is improved
evidently. We take two performance targets, image reconstruction error and
correlation coefficient, to evaluate the improvement. The images and the data
show that threshold strategy is effective and achievable.
